Incident

Correctional Officer Justin Pedigo was stabbed and killed by an inmate at the Morgan County Correctional Complex at 541 Wayne Cotton Morgan Drive in Wartburg.

The suspect was serving a sentence for aggravated assault and attempted voluntary manslaughter. He has been moved to another facility.

Officer Pedigo had served with the Tennessee Department of Correction for 10 months.

Survivors

Survivors include his wife, parents, brother, and sister.
